How to choose a 12V inverter for car camping and RV?
When embarking on camping or RV adventures, having a reliable power source is crucial. A 12V car inverter allows you to convert your vehicle's DC power into AC power, enabling you to run household appliances and charge devices while off-grid. However, selecting the right inverter can be challenging, especially for beginners. Below are six specific questions frequently asked by newcomers, along with in-depth answers to guide your decision-making process.
1. How do I determine the appropriate wattage for my 12V car inverter?
To select the right inverter wattage, list all the devices you intend to use simultaneously and note their power requirements. For instance, a laptop may require 100W, a coffee maker 800W, and a microwave 1,000W. Add these values to determine your total wattage needs. It's advisable to choose an inverter with a continuous wattage rating at least 20–25% higher than your calculated total to accommodate startup surges and ensure safe operation.
2. What is the difference between pure sine wave and modified sine wave inverters, and which should I choose?
Pure sine wave inverters produce a clean, smooth output similar to grid power, making them suitable for sensitive electronics like laptops, medical devices, and audio equipment. Modified sine wave inverters are less expensive but can cause interference with sensitive devices and may not power them efficiently. For camping and RV use, especially if you plan to run sensitive electronics, a pure sine wave inverter is recommended.
3. How do I account for surge wattage requirements when selecting an inverter?
Many appliances, particularly those with motors (e.g., refrigerators, air conditioners), require additional power during startup, known as surge wattage. For example, a refrigerator may need 1,200W to start but only 150–800W to run. Ensure your chosen inverter can handle these surge demands by checking its surge wattage rating. It's advisable to select an inverter with a surge capacity at least equal to the highest surge requirement of your appliances.
4. What safety features should I look for in a 12V car inverter?
Essential safety features include over-voltage, under-voltage, overload, and thermal protection. These features prevent damage to both the inverter and connected devices by automatically shutting down or adjusting operation under unsafe conditions. Additionally, certifications like UL, CE, and RoHS indicate compliance with international safety standards.
5. How do I ensure my vehicle's battery can support the inverter's power demands?
Calculate the total wattage of devices you plan to run and divide by your battery voltage (typically 12V) to determine the required current in amperes. For example, a 1,000W inverter requires approximately 83.3A (1,000W ÷ 12V = 83.3A). Ensure your vehicle's battery capacity and alternator can handle this load, considering efficiency losses and depth of discharge. It's also advisable to have a deep-cycle battery designed for deep discharges to extend its lifespan.
6. Are there additional features or considerations to enhance my camping experience with a 12V car inverter?
Look for inverters with multiple AC outlets and USB ports to charge various devices simultaneously. Some models offer remote controls or mobile app connectivity for convenient operation. Ensure the inverter has a cooling fan to prevent overheating during extended use. Additionally, consider the inverter's efficiency rating; higher efficiency reduces energy loss and extends battery life.
